DESCRIPTION:CT (Cognitively Based Compassion Training) Fall 2026 – Invitation to Apply \nCBCT is one of the longest-running and most studied compassion training protocols of its kind\, created by Dr. Tenzin Negi\, Director of the Contemplative Sciences and Compassion Based Ethics Department at Emory University. CBCT offers a comprehensive method for training compassion\, supported by scientific research in fields such as evolutionary biology\, psychology\, and neuroscience. CBCT is a secular program based on the Buddhist Lo Jong (mind-training) tradition. \nBefore applying\, please make certain you can meet all requirements.  Although the program is being offered at no-cost to you\, the value to participants is priceless.
